> Consider removing useOriginalMessage functionality

> This feature is a bit more complex and its intention/design was to in case of
> an error during routing, you could say, that the original incoming message
> should be restored as-is and used as "result", for example in case you want
> to move that message to some dead letter queue or log it etc.
> However people may mis-understand this, and think you can mix the original
> message BODY only and enrich it with any existing headers at the time of
> error - but that was not how it was designed/intended.
> However a few EIPs and if you turned on shared unit of work, you could end up
> with situations where it would mix the original message with the message of
> error.
> If the user wants to mix both the original message with the message at the
> error, then they should use a bean/processor/aggregation strategy etc to
> "merge" the data together as they want. NOT rely on just saying
> useOriginalMessage and "hope for the best".
> Also the original message body, can when you transfer messages over Camel
> endpoints be stored at new endpoints such as JMS, direct-vm etc whom creates
> a new exchange. And if you use direct, and other internals it would not. So
> it can be a bit unclear where such original message would origin from.
> Instead we should let the user use the Claim Check EIP pattern where you can
> explict set safe points with the original message, and easily merge data back
> agains, such as the message body only etc.
